解説

This book discusses the role of sustainable biomanufacturing in advancing Industry 5.0, achieving carbon neutrality, and fostering innovation in diverse sectors. It emphasizes the integration of cutting-edge technologies, such as artificial intelligence and machine learning, with sustainable practices to address global challenges in manufacturing, environmental conservation, and resource management. The initial chapters explore the foundational concepts, historical evolution, and applications of sustainable biomanufacturing, alongside its contributions to the UN Sustainable Development Goals and the circular economy. The subsequent chapters present real-world case studies highlighting biomanufacturing innovations across industries, including bioenergy, biomedical engineering, agriculture, food production, personal care, and cosmetics. It further examines the role of advanced tools and techniques in creating sustainable enzymes, biocatalysts, and biochemicals while discussing industry-driven solutions for CO2 sequestration and carbon neutrality.

Key Features:

  • Explores the foundations of sustainable biomanufacturing and its role in addressing global sustainability challenges
  • Highlights real-world applications across industries, including bioenergy, healthcare, agriculture, and cosmetics
  • Discusses innovative tools, such as artificial intelligence (AI) and machine learning, to enhance sustainable production systems
  • Provides insights into governance policies, life cycle assessment, and research trends for sustainable manufacturing
  • Examines future opportunities, bridging the gap between industry needs and sustainable innovation

This book is useful for professionals in biotechnology and environmental sciences.
